Offer description

About The Role

The role is responsible for executing and managing email marketing campaigns across six market locales, including building, testing, and launching campaigns while ensuring timely asset delivery. Additionally, the role supports senior specialists in campaign planning, performance analysis, competitor reporting, and database growth initiatives to optimize email marketing strategies.


Key Responsibilities

* Owns Email campaign delivery and execution across 6 market locales – builds all Email campaigns in ESP platform for each local market, tests and QA Email campaigns, creates audience segment and builds journey for execution
* Brief EMEA Creative on all email marketing campaign, as planned by Senior Specialist, to deliver against email calendar requirements and campaign objectives
* Responsible for ensuring all assets, imagery and products are delivered within deadlines for the campaign build process
* Supports Email team (Senior Specialists) with planning innovative email marketing campaigns for Men’s and Store Activity, collaborating with partners in Ecommerce, Product and Brand where relevant
* Supports Email team (Senior Specialists) with email performance and competitor reporting and draw actionable insights to help continuously optimize email results
* Support Email team (Senior Specialist) with database growth initiatives, briefing in requirements to EMEA Creative and reporting on performance weekly to drive forward the strategy


Who You Are

* Previous experience with ESPs (Salesforce Marketing Cloud desired), preferably at an agency or DTC retailer with e-commerce focus required (minimum 2 years)
* Ambitious team player with desire to improve and innovate the email channel
* Ability to translate ideas or insights into well-constructed creative briefs.
* Foundational understanding of email marketing, journeys and reporting, including segmentation, personalisation, and automation.
* Knowledge of email design and best practices
* Understanding of all CRM KPIs, how they are calculated and when to be used across weekly/monthly/quarterly trade meetings
* Demonstrates agility and strong time management and prioritisation skills.
* This is a hybrid role based in Central London, requiring three days in the office.
